Output 842334704dd72b359a1be2cf81d17e0d3b09799716e491bdb7e45e83e724570e:0

value
42582613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b59af403d53f490ca6b393615f0e53831572972e OP_EQUAL
address
3JFFrbozzPLsjLpdw7ooChtZ98TvR3kEWp
transaction
842334704dd72b359a1be2cf81d17e0d3b09799716e491bdb7e45e83e724570e